Output 95cdca5871aa63d1f7b8fce0a1d4e12ec233bae31dc8fe4eaffd4c5aae6a362c:1

value
264004422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87b65b02bf2ad71a8350091ab767188f304f3ac9 OP_EQUAL
address
3E4bbiwLeWgmdsEc83aXtdurSbmy1fFcSX
transaction
95cdca5871aa63d1f7b8fce0a1d4e12ec233bae31dc8fe4eaffd4c5aae6a362c
confirmations
437875
spent
true